A delay from 2 to 3 system clock cycles is added to TD output when:
TCMR.START = Receive Start,
TCMR.STTDLY = more than ZERO,
RCMR.START = Start on falling edge / Start on Rising edge / Start on any edge,
RFMR.FSOS = None (input).
Fix/Workaround
None.
TF output is not correct (at least emitted one serial clock cycle later than expected) when:
TFMR.FSOS = Driven Low during data transfer/ Driven High during data transfer
TCMR.START = Receive start
RFMR.FSOS = None (Input)
RCMR.START = any on RF (edge/level)
Fix/Workaround
None.
The frame synchro and the frame synchro data are delayed from 1 SSC_CLOCK when:
- Clock is CKDIV
- The START is selected on either a frame synchro edge or a level
- Frame synchro data is enabled
- Transmit clock is gated on output (through CKO field)
Fix/Workaround
Transmit or receive CLOCK must not be gated (by the mean of CKO field) when START
condition is performed on a generated frame synchro.

If the ADC sleep mode is activated when the ADC is idle the ADC will not enter sleep mode
before after the next AD conversion.
Fix/Workaround
Activate the sleep mode in the mode register and then perform an AD conversion.
Wrong PDCA behavior when using two PDCA channels with the same PID.
Fix/Workaround
The same PID should not be assigned to more than one channel.
